How they compare

Iran currently reports 30.41 against 20.83 in South-eastern Asia (UNSDG), a difference of 9.58.

That makes Iran's figure about 1.5 times South-eastern Asia (UNSDG)'s.

Across all 23 years both countries report, Iran has been ahead every year.

Iran ranks 74th and South-eastern Asia (UNSDG) ranks 73rd of 193 countries.

Iran has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ade Iran South-eastern Asia (UNSDG) Difference Ahead
2000s 18.27 8.01 10.26 Iran
2010s 24.05 13.95 10.1 Iran
2020s 29.46 19.78 9.68 Iran

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
